About
I'm a research fellow at National University of Singapore (NUS), hosted by Prof Abhik Roychoudhury. Before that, I received my doctoral degree from Tsinghua University, advised by Prof Yu Jiang, and BS degree from Beijing University of Posts and Telecommunications (BUPT).
Research
My research focuses on ensuring the security and privacy of real-world systems (e.g., network protocols, IoT platforms) through program analysis, software testing, and reverse engineering techniques. Currently, I am exploring how LLMs can revolutionize these methods with superior reasoning capabilities and cross-domain scalability.
